Article: Mushrooms THEY'LL GROW ON YOU Earthy flavors emerge from the dark

Looking for a new taste sensation?

Go ahead, try some mushrooms. They'll grow on you.

Well, OK. They may not grow on you, or even in the dirt behind your 7-year-old's ear, but the flavor will. Some people warm to the earthy taste of mushrooms instantly. But many people develop an enjoyment for them over time. Mushrooms may be an acquired taste, like bittersweet chocolate or a fine red wine.

On the other hand, you may never fall in love with these fabulous fungi. At least, that's the message from Eric Rose, owner of River Valley Mushroom Farm in Slades Corners, on Highway 50 in western Kenosha County, about seven miles south of Burlington.
